WEB頁(yè)面工具語(yǔ)言XML帶來(lái)的好處(2)_Xml教程
推薦:為何XML對(duì)Web服務(wù)很重要與其它Web服務(wù)技術(shù)相比,標(biāo)準(zhǔn)化是XML特色之一。XML提供了Web服務(wù)應(yīng)用程序之間傳輸數(shù)據(jù)的標(biāo)準(zhǔn)格式。萬(wàn)維網(wǎng)聯(lián)盟(W3C)管理XML標(biāo)準(zhǔn)并發(fā)布給全球的XML技術(shù)提供者,這就確保了XML產(chǎn)品的兼容性。
(8)粒狀的更新
通過(guò)XML,數(shù)據(jù)可以粒狀的更新。每當(dāng)一部分?jǐn)?shù)據(jù)變化后,不需要重發(fā)整個(gè)結(jié)構(gòu)化的數(shù)據(jù)。變化的元素必須從服務(wù)器發(fā)送給客戶,變化的數(shù)據(jù)不需要刷新整個(gè)使用者的界面就能夠顯示出來(lái)。目前,只要一條數(shù)據(jù)變化了,整一頁(yè)都必須重建。這嚴(yán)重限制了服務(wù)器的升級(jí)性能。XML也允許加進(jìn)其他數(shù)據(jù),比如預(yù)測(cè)的溫度。加入的信息能夠流入存在的頁(yè)面,不需要瀏覽器發(fā)一個(gè)新的頁(yè)面。
(9)在Web上發(fā)布數(shù)據(jù)
由于XML是一個(gè)開(kāi)放的基于文本的格式,它可以和HTML一樣使用HTTP進(jìn)行傳送,不需要對(duì)現(xiàn)存的網(wǎng)絡(luò)進(jìn)行變化。
(10)升級(jí)性
由于XML徹底把標(biāo)識(shí)的概念同顯示分開(kāi),處理者能夠在結(jié)構(gòu)化的數(shù)據(jù)中嵌套程序化的描述以表明如何顯示數(shù)據(jù)。這是令人難以相信的強(qiáng)大的機(jī)制,使得客戶計(jì)算機(jī)同使用者間的交互作用盡可能的減少了,同時(shí)減少了服務(wù)器的數(shù)據(jù)交換量和瀏覽器的響應(yīng)時(shí)間。另外,XML使個(gè)人的數(shù)據(jù)只能通過(guò)更新的布告發(fā)生變化,減少了服務(wù)器的工作量,大大增強(qiáng)了服務(wù)器的升級(jí)性能。
(11)壓縮性
XML壓縮性能很好,因?yàn)橛糜诿枋鰯?shù)據(jù)結(jié)構(gòu)的標(biāo)簽可以重復(fù)使用。XML數(shù)據(jù)是否要壓縮要根據(jù)應(yīng)用來(lái)定,還取決于服務(wù)器與客戶間數(shù)據(jù)的傳遞量。XML能夠使用HTTP1.1中的壓縮標(biāo)準(zhǔn)。
(12)開(kāi)放的標(biāo)準(zhǔn)
XML基于的標(biāo)準(zhǔn)是為Web進(jìn)行過(guò)優(yōu)化的。微軟和其他一些公司以及W3C中的工作組正致力于確保XML的互用性,以及為開(kāi)發(fā)人員、處理人員和不同系統(tǒng)和瀏覽器的使用者提供支持,并進(jìn)一步發(fā)展XML的標(biāo)準(zhǔn)。
XML包括一套相關(guān)的標(biāo)準(zhǔn):
可擴(kuò)展標(biāo)識(shí)語(yǔ)言(XML)標(biāo)準(zhǔn),這是W3C正式批準(zhǔn)的。這意味著這個(gè)標(biāo)準(zhǔn)是穩(wěn)定的,完全可用于Web和工具的開(kāi)發(fā)。
XML名域標(biāo)準(zhǔn),這用來(lái)描述名域的句法,支持能識(shí)別名域的XML解析器。
分享:用XML數(shù)據(jù)島結(jié)合Dom制作通訊錄一般情況下,如果要為網(wǎng)站提供一個(gè)通訊錄程序,需要使用CGI結(jié)合后臺(tái)數(shù)據(jù)庫(kù)技術(shù),這對(duì)WEB服務(wù)器的要求比較高,在很多不提供數(shù)據(jù)庫(kù)功能的虛擬主機(jī)上甚至無(wú)法實(shí)現(xiàn)。當(dāng)然,我們還可以采用TXT文本替
- xml創(chuàng)建節(jié)點(diǎn)(根節(jié)點(diǎn)、子節(jié)點(diǎn))
- WML開(kāi)發(fā)教程之 WAP網(wǎng)站服務(wù)器配置方法
- WMLScript的語(yǔ)法基礎(chǔ)
- 收集的WML Script標(biāo)準(zhǔn)函數(shù)庫(kù)
- WML教程之文本框控件Input
- 無(wú)線標(biāo)記語(yǔ)言(WML)基礎(chǔ)之WMLScript 基礎(chǔ)
- xml文件的結(jié)構(gòu)解讀
- 關(guān)于XSL - XSL教程
- 選擇模式 - XSL教程 - 2
- XPath入門 - XSL教程 - 3
- 匹配模式 - XSL教程 - 4
- 測(cè)試模式 - XSL教程 - 5
- 相關(guān)鏈接:
- 教程說(shuō)明:
Xml教程-WEB頁(yè)面工具語(yǔ)言XML帶來(lái)的好處(2)
。